A leading technology firm based in Kyle of Lochalsh is seeking a Project Manager to oversee projects for the Royal Navy, focusing on underwater technology and systems. This role requires proven project management skills, effective communication with remote teams, and stakeholder engagement. The ideal candidate will hold a project management qualification and preferably have experience in defense or engineering. Join a collaborative environment pushing the boundaries of technology and innovation.

How to prepare for a job interview at QINETIQ LIMITED

✨Know Your Underwater Tech

Make sure you brush up on the latest trends and technologies in underwater systems. Being able to discuss specific projects or innovations will show your passion and expertise in the field, which is crucial for a role focused on the Royal Navy.

✨Showcase Your Project Management Skills

Prepare examples from your past experiences that highlight your project management qualifications.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ers, demonstrating how you've successfully led projects, especially in defence or engineering.

✨Communicate Effectively

Since this role involves working with remote teams, practice articulating your thoughts clearly and concisely. Be ready to discuss how you’ve managed communication across different time zones and cultures, ensuring everyone stays aligned and engaged.

✨Engage with Stakeholders

Think of instances where you've successfully engaged stakeholders in previous projects. Be prepared to discuss your approach to building relationships and managing expectations, as this will be key in a collaborative environment like BUTEC.
